Emeralds Confirmed in Foal

While the stable continues to prepare for a big weekend of racing in the hopes of picking up Group 1 glory in the Flight Stakes with either Four Moves Ahead or Left Reeling, we are also celebrating some very special news.

5 year old Sebring mare and older half sister to Four Moves Ahead – EMERALDS is confirmed in foal to champion race horse (possibly the best in the world) Frankel. The news was received from the office of Jonathan Munz’s Pinecliff Racing that the black type mare has had her 16 weeks scans which have confirmed the pregnancy.

Emeralds was initially offered at the 2018 Inglis Easter Yearling sale but when she failed to meet her reserve of $150,000 she was retained by Pinecliff racing and sent to John. The chestnut filly was first seen at the trials in October of 2018 before she made her racing debut in the Group 2 Sweet Embrace Stakes in March of 2019 where she finished down the field. She was then sent out for a break and returned to the race track at Newcastle in June.

At start number 3 she broke her maiden in strong style at Kembla over 1400m with Andrew Gibbons in the red and white silks. Later in the year she lined up in the Group 2 Tea Rose stakes and finished an impressive 4th behind the then top fillies in Funstar and Probabeel. Another of her career highlight wins was when she upset the front running Greysful Glamour in the Group 3 Angst Stakes at Randwick in October last year.

Emeralds raced 18 times, recording 3 wins and 4 minor placings.

After her run in the Group 1 Tatts Tiara, the decision was made to retire her and send her to the breeding barn. Many discussions were had to find a suitable mating partner for her, shortly after the decision was then made to send her to the Northern Hemisphere where she would meet the worlds best race horse in FRANKEL.

Frankel is a horse that needs no introduction in racing, he is a multiple Group performed winner around the world. Since retiring to stud he has continued on his winning ways, siring 19 Group 1 winners and is the leading sire in Europe by prizemoney.
